Ford Mondeo 1996 vs Ford Mondeo 2003
| Gearbox: | Manual | Manual | |
|---|---|---|---|
| Engine: | 2.0 Petrol | 2.0 Petrol | |
| Camshaft drive: | Timing belt | Timing chain | |
| Timing belt usually needs to be replaced more often than the chain, but it is usually significantly cheaper. Timing belt motors are generally quieter and less vibrating than chain motors. | |||
Performance | |||
| Power: | 131 HP | 145 HP | |
| Torque: | 176 NM | 190 NM | |
| Acceleration 0-100 km/h: | 10.3 seconds | 10.2 seconds | |
|
Ford Mondeo 2003 is a more dynamic driving. Ford Mondeo 1996 engine produces 14 HP less power than Ford Mondeo 2003, whereas torque is 14 NM less than Ford Mondeo 2003. Due to the lower power, Ford Mondeo 1996 reaches 100 km/h speed 0.1 seconds later. | |||
Fuel consumption | |||
| Fuel consumption (l/100km): | 8.4 | 8.1 | |
| Real fuel consumption: | 8.4 l/100km | 8.5 l/100km | |
|
By specification Ford Mondeo 1996 consumes 0.3 litres more fuel per 100 km than the Ford Mondeo 2003, which means that if you drive 15,000 km in a year, the Ford Mondeo 1996 could require 45 litres more fuel. But when we compare the real fuel consumption reported by users, Ford Mondeo 1996 consumes 0.1 litres less fuel per 100 km than the Ford Mondeo 2003. | |||
| Fuel tank capacity: | 62 litres | 59 litres | |
| Full fuel tank distance: | 730 km in combined cycle | 720 km in combined cycle | |
| 950 km on highway | 950 km on highway | ||
| 730 km with real consumption | 690 km with real consumption | ||

Engines | |||
| Average engine lifespan: | 480'000 km | 560'000 km | |
| Engine resource depends largely on regular maintenance and the quality of the oils and fuels used, but under equal conditions the average life of a Ford Mondeo 2003 engine could be longer. | |||
| Engine production duration: | 5 years | 7 years | |
| Engine spread: | Used also on Ford Scorpio | Used only for this car | |
| In general, the longer and for more car models an engine is produced, the better its serviceability and availability of spare parts. Ford Mondeo 1996 might be a better choice in this respect. | |||
| Hydraulic tappets: | yes | no | |
| The Ford Mondeo 1996 engine has hydraulic tappets (lifters), providing quieter operation and no need for periodic adjustment, but they are more complex in design and can cause serious engine damage in case of failure. | |||
Dimensions | |||
| Length: | 4.67 m | 4.80 m | |
| Width: | 1.75 m | 1.81 m | |
| Height: | 1.39 m | 1.44 m | |
|
Ford Mondeo 1996 is smaller. Ford Mondeo 1996 is 13 cm shorter than the Ford Mondeo 2003, 6 cm narrower, while the height of Ford Mondeo 1996 is 5 cm lower. | |||
| Trunk capacity: | 540 litres | 540 litres | |
| Trunk max capacity: with rear seats folded down, if possible |
1610 litres | 1700 litres | |
| Turning diameter: | 10.3 meters | 11.1 meters | |
| The turning circle of the Ford Mondeo 1996 is 0.8 metres less than that of the Ford Mondeo 2003, which means Ford Mondeo 1996 can be easier to manoeuvre in tight streets and parking spaces. | |||
